The Lumina Intelligence UK Pub & Bar Market Report 2026 provides a comprehensive review of one of the UK’s most important hospitality sectors as it navigates continued economic pressure, changing consumer habits and evolving pub operating models.
Drawing on Lumina Intelligence’s proprietary market sizing, consumer research and operator analysis programmes, this report explores how pub operators, suppliers and investors can adapt to a market increasingly defined by premiumisation, experience-led occasions and operational efficiency.
Positioned as both a reflection of current market conditions and a forward-looking guide to 2029, the report equips stakeholders with the insight needed to identify growth opportunities and build resilience in a challenging trading environment.

This report combines Lumina Intelligence’s proprietary datasets with external indicators to deliver a detailed and evidence-led view of the UK pub and bar market.
Market Sizing & Operator Analysis – Detailed analysis of pub and bar market value, outlet numbers and performance across managed, branded, franchised, independent, tenanted and leased operators.
Eating & Drinking Out Panel – Continuous tracking of consumer behaviour, occasions, spend patterns and purchasing decisions across a nationally representative UK consumer panel.
Operator Data Index – Comprehensive monitoring of operator performance, outlet changes, brand development and market share movements across the UK hospitality market.
Consumer Behaviour & Occasion Analysis – Detailed analysis of key pub occasions including socialising, drinking, dining, relaxation and treat-led missions.
Macroeconomic & Industry Indicators – Integration of economic, consumer confidence and regulatory datasets to provide context for market performance and future forecasts.
